Information:


Install valve bridges (6) to the valve stems.Note: Install used valve bridges in the original location and in the original orientation. Ensure that the valve bridges are correctly seated on the valves. New valve bridges may be installed in either orientation.
Illustration 2 g02004093
Clean the pushrods. Inspect the pushrods for wear and damage. Replace any pushrods that are worn or damaged.
Apply clean engine lubricating oil to both ends of pushrods (9) . Install the pushrods to the engine with the cup upward.Note: Ensure that the pushrods are installed in the original location and that the ball end of each pushrod is correctly seated in the valve lifters.
Illustration 3 g02085993
If necessary, use Tooling (A) in order to rotate the crankshaft so that number one piston is at top dead center on the compression stroke. Refer to System Operation, Testing and Adjusting, "Position the Valve Mechanism Before Maintenance Procedures" for the correct procedure. Install Tooling (B) through Hole (W) in order to lock the crankshaft.Note: Do not use excessive force to install Tooling (B) . Do not use Tooling (B) to hold the crankshaft during repairs.
Remove Tooling (B) .
Failure to ensure that the crankshaft is positioned at 60 degrees before or after top dead center will cause interference between the pistons and valves. Failure to ensure that the crankshaft is positioned at 60 degrees before or after top dead center will result in damage to the engine.
Use Tooling (A) in order to rotate the crankshaft to 60 degrees before or after top dead center.
Illustration 4 g02003035
Illustration 5 g02307257
Ensure that the rocker shaft assembly is clean and free from wear and damage.
Position the rockershaft assembly with Spotfaces (Y) for Torx screws (7) in the up ward position.
Install Tooling (E) to rocker shaft assembly.
Install Torx screws (7) to the rocker shaft.Note: Ensure that correct Torx screw (7) is installed to Position (X) .
Illustration 6 g02004078
Illustration 7 g02003036
Illustration 8 g02047334
Ensure that ALL threaded inserts are fully unscrewed.
Damage to the engine will occur if all threaded inserts are not fully unscrewed.
Position rocker shaft assembly (8) onto the cylinder head. The retaining clip (10) should face the front of the engine.Note: Ensure that the threaded inserts are correctly seated in ends of pushrods (9) .
Use Tooling (D) in order to tighten Torx screws (7) hand tight.
Remove Tooling (E) from the rocker shaft. Install the remaining Torx screws (7) to the rocker shaft. Tighten the Torx screws (7) hand tight.
Tighten the Torx screws to a torque of 35 N m (26 lb ft) in the numerical sequence that is shown in Illustration 8.
Ensure that valve bridges (6) are correctly located on the valve stems.
Illustration 9 g01992077
Ensure that guides (5) for the pushrods are correctly positioned on threaded inserts (4) . Use Tooling (C) in order to tighten threaded inserts (4) on all the rocker arms. Tighten the threaded inserts to a torque of 30 N m (265 lb in).Note: When the threaded insert is tightened, the threaded insert must seat correctly into the cup for the pushrod.
Illustration 10 g01992076
